Mattel

The leader of the modern toy industry, Mattel produces a huge number of toys that are sold in 150 countries around the world. The company's factories are located in China, Indonesia, Malaysia, Mexico and Thailand. The company also works with contractors in the US, Europe, Southeast Asia and Australia. Several generations of American children have grown up on Mattel toys - and already two generations of Russian ones.

The music box is one of Mattel's first popular toys (1952).

The company appeared in 1945 and got its name from the first letters of the names of its founders: Harold Matson (Matt) and Elliot Handler (El). Initially, Mattel was engaged in the production of plastic and wooden furniture and baguettes - and the waste from the main production went to toy furniture for dolls. Gradually, the toy business became the main one. Under the company's brand, popular plastic guitars, toy pianos and music boxes were released to the market. Mattel's earnings have grown steadily. In 1956, the company decided to take a step that forever changed the toy industry - Elliot Handler and his wife Ruth, who was in charge of the company's finances, decided to sponsor the 15-minute program "The Mickey Mouse Club" on ABC, and the contract was signed for a year. The idea of ​​directing ads directly to children was new, but the rapid growth in sales confirmed its promise - in two years, Mattel's sales tripled. And in 1959, another epoch-making event took place in toy history - Mattel introduced the Barbie doll, the most popular toy in recent human history. The idea for the doll came from Ruth Handler, who noticed that their teenage daughter liked paper dolls depicting adult women much more than toy baby dolls. The Handlers named the new doll Barbara after their daughter. Barbie instantly gained immense popularity - within a few years, fan clubs of your favorite toy began to appear all over America, in which by 1968 there were 1.5 million fans. The company actively developed other toys - it was she who introduced the first talking dolls, walking dolls, dolls with moving lips and eyes. A great success in the field of "boy" toys was the HotWheels series of toy cars, which are still popular today. A close collaboration with Disney has brought great results - Mattel is the sponsor of many attractions in Disneyland, and also develops toys specifically for these theme parks. In addition to the heroes of Disney cartoons, almost all the characters of cartoons beloved by children - Tom and Jerry, the Flintstones, Harry Potter, Sponge Bob and many others have been noted in the company's lineup over the past decades. But of course, the most famous work of Mattel and still remains the Barbie doll. According to statistics, during the heyday of plastic beauty, in the 90s, every American girl aged 3 to 11 had at least two or three Barbie dolls. In a year, the company brought to the market up to 50 new types of the famous doll - and this is not counting related products, which included everything from shoes and clothes to backpacks, furniture and cosmetics. Since the birth of Barbie, more than a billion copies of this doll have been sold, and during the celebration of the bicentenary of the declaration of independence of the United States in 1976, the Barbie doll was included in the number of "cult" items included in the American time capsule. Today, Barbie dolls have fallen somewhat behind new doll idols (like Bratz and Moxxi), but still have a solid place on the shelves of any children's store - and continue to bring huge income to Mattel.

Hasbro

The second largest (after Mattel) toy company in the world, Hasbro is also a long-lived toy industry. The company is currently headquartered in Rhode Island, but Hasbro's manufacturing facilities are scattered around the world. The company was founded in New Jersey by brothers Henry and Gelal Hassenfeld under the name HassenfeldBrothers.

Mr. Potato Head is a landmark Hasbro toy.

Initially, the company was engaged in the processing of textiles, but gradually moved to the production of pencil cases and school supplies. In the 1940s, the company began producing the first toys - these were suitcases with toy medical supplies, which are still very popular with children today. However, the first real hit of the company was another toy - a collapsible doll " Mr Potato Head"(1952), familiar to modern children from the cartoon "Toy Story". In 1968, the company shortened its name to Hasbro, formed from the first letters of the words Hassenfeld Brothers. By this time, her assortment included many "landmark" toys - for example, "Soldier Joe", the first super-popular role-playing figure, which became for boys what the Barbie doll was for girls. Another truly historic Hasbro toy was introduced in 1984 - it was a toy horse " My little Pony”, which originally appeared after the cartoon of the same name, but gradually turned into an independent brand and enjoys great love of little girls to this day. Well, for boys around the same time, the company began to produce the first transformer toys - militant machines that could transform into cars or humanoid combat robots. Like " My Little Pony », transformer toys formed their own subculture and do not leave the store shelves to this day.

My Little Pony first appeared under the Hasbro brand in 1983.

In addition to its own developments, Hasbro included in its lineup toys under the brands Milton Bradley, CBS, Parker Brothers - well-known companies in their time, which were absorbed by Hasbro and today exist as subsidiaries of this giant. So hits such as Pokemon or Monopoly, the most popular board game of modern times, appeared in the Hasbro assortment. One way or another, Hasbro is now second after Mattel, although it is believed that it would have every chance of leadership if it were not for the ever-young and ever-popular Barbie.

fisher price

famous brand educational toys for toddlers Fisher Price appeared in the 1930s. The name of the company was formed by adding the names of the founders - Herman Fischer and Irwin Price. Also among the founders of this toy enterprise were Price's wife Margaret Evans Price, who was engaged in decoration and design, and Helen Schelle, the owner of a toy store.

The Musical Elephant is an incredibly popular Fisher Price toy that almost every older American had at one time (1948).

WITH From the very beginning of its activity, Fisher Price focused on toys that would be interesting to children of different ages, would have sufficient durability, would have great developmental potential, and at the same time, would not be expensive enough - after all, the founders of the company remembered the years of the Great Depression well in USA. First Fisher Price toys Made from yellow pine and steel, they could easily withstand the most intense games - and the bright and colorful design, designed by Margaret Price, attracted attention and delighted the eye. The company made its debut with children's wheelchair toys, depicting characters from popular children's books (for example, Dr. Doodle's goose). In the early 50s, the company was one of the first to abandon wood in favor of plastic, which was easier to process and retained color longer. In the 1960s, Fisher Price began producing Little People toys - educational models, play sets, books and discs under this brand are still popular today. Today, the company, which has developed more than 5,000 models of toys during its existence, produces children's goods and toys for children of primary and preschool age, including games and goods with the symbols of Winnie the Pooh, the explorer Dora (in the Russian version of Dasha the Pathfinder) and Kung Fu Panda under license from the respective film companies. The Fisher Price brand is currently owned by Mattel.

Crayola

The American company Crayola, specializing in the production of art products, was founded in 1885 and is one of the oldest participants in the children's goods market. The founders of the company, which later became a giant of the industry, were cousins ​​Edwin Binney (EdwinBinney) and Harold Smith (HaroldSmith), who without much fanfare called their company Binney & Smith.

Initially, the company specialized in the production of industrial dyes using red iron oxide pigment and lamp soot, and the technology they developed for the production of inexpensive black dyes even won a gold medal at the Paris Exhibition in 1900. In the same year, the company began producing school slate pencils. And experiments with slate waste, cement and talc led to the creation of the first dust-free white chalk for drawing. Finally, in 1903, Edwin Binney created the first wax crayons, which went on sale on June 10, 1903 under the name Crayola (this name was invented by Edwin's wife, Alice Binney, who worked as a school teacher). The name was composed of two parts: crai (French "chalk") and ola (oleaginous, oily). By 1905, the company was offering wax crayons in 18 different sets and 5 sizes. The assortment of the company included both professional sets for artists and small kits for children's creativity. The color palette gradually expanded - for example, in 1939 it introduced a set of crayons, consisting of 52 colors, and in 1958 a set of 64 crayons Crayola appeared on the shelves. Today, the most numerous set of Crayola has 200 colors, although the standard sets of 8,16, 24, 32, 48 and 64 crayons are more popular. In addition to the usual crayons, Crayola also produces crayons with special effects - for example, with iridescent or metallic colors. Today, branded yellow boxes with the famous Crayola logo can be found in any children's goods store. Crayola products are very popular both in the home of this company, in the United States, and around the world. In 2003, in commemoration of the centenary of the Crayola brand, the largest crayon in the world was created at the company's factory - a blue giant with a height of 4.7 meters and a weight of 680 kg. The chalk was smelted from the remains of used Crayola crayons, which were specially collected by American children for this purpose. And in 1998, the US National Postal Service honored Crayola's contribution to American history with a special stamp.

Postage stamp with the first box of Crayola crayons

In addition to their famous crayons, Crayola currently produces a wide range of popular art products: colour pencils, felt-tip pens, markers, inks and paints, plasticine, coloring books and sets for children's creativity. The company also owns the brand of original mass for modeling SillyPutty, which has been very popular in the USA for half a century, and today it is gradually appearing in Russian stores. All Crayola products are high quality, non-toxic and suitable for children of all ages.

Lego


The first plastic Lego bricks were empty inside and could be used as rattles.

Lego is one of the most famous toy manufacturers in the world - and no wonder. After all, this Danish company produces plastic constructors for over 60 years. The famous company was founded by Ole Kirk Christiansen, a carpenter who made wooden toys and was one of the first to see the prospects of plastic as a material for children's building kits. The name of the Lego company is derived from the Danish words LegGodt, which means "play well". In 1949, the first set of "Self-Connecting Bricks" was born, which could be attached to each other. However, sales were not going very well - in Europe they did not trust plastic, and often already sold goods were returned back because of their unusual appearance. Everything changed only in 1954, when the son of its founder, Godtfred Kirk Christiansen, came to the management of the company. He quickly realized the advantages of the plastic construction set as a system product - and by 1958, self-connecting bricks had evolved into the details of our modern look. All Lego pieces released since that time are fully compatible with each other, regardless of the level of complexity and the date of publication of the set to which they belong. By the way, the production of parts of the desired size is not so simple: after all, all parts of the designer must hold tightly to each other, but if necessary, they can be easily and quickly separated without special devices. The development of new models involved 120 designers at the company's headquarters, which is located in Billund, Denmark. In addition, the company has small branches in Ukraine, Spain, Germany and Japan, which develop products adapted to local markets. The Lego assortment includes both ordinary universal constructors and sets dedicated to individual topics: cities, space, robots, pirates, trains, Vikings, castles, dinosaurs, etc. Only toys dedicated to war and military operations have never been in the Lego model line and not now (the founder of the company, Ole Christiansen, believed that war had no place in children's games). Lego production facilities are located in Denmark, Hungary, Mexico and the Czech Republic. The machines on which Lego constructors are produced have an error of no more than 10 microns. The pieces are molded from ABS plastic and are manually inspected for significant differences in color or size at the exit - according to Lego statistics, approximately 18 parts per million do not meet the standard. Up to 20 billion parts are produced annually (600 parts per second). And if all the Lego parts made to date are divided among the six billion population of the Earth, then each person will receive 62 parts. For fans of constructors (of which there are many not only among children, but also among adults), five huge theme amusement parks have been built, including many buildings from the details of the famous designer. The first Legoland was opened in the home of Lego in Danish Bylund in 1968. It was followed by parks in Windsor (UK), Günzburg (Germany) and California.

Zolo was founded in the USA in 1986. Its origins were Sandra Higashi and Byron Glaser, professional designers - and young parents. In an effort to bring creativity to all areas of their lives, they were looking for toys that did not limit, but stimulated the child's imagination in the game. However, conventional designers offered only standard schemes for standard models. Then, sitting in their own kitchen with crayons and markers in hand, Higashi and Glazer created sketches of amazingly fun details that didn't seem to fit at all - yet came together in incredible designs that could be animals, insects, objects, or practically anything.

In the mid-eighties, the idea of ​​​​such transformations was too bold, and the new designer seemed too extravagant. The project was consistently rejected by three leading toy manufacturers. However, Higashi and Glazer did not give up. Soon, the designer's sketches found their realization in the form of bright, pleasant to the touch wooden and foam rubber parts, which were connected to each other with the help of holes and pins. At the same time, holes and pins could be located anywhere on the parts - and each new combination made it possible to create extraordinary, unique and very funny objects. The new construction set was packed in a wooden box with a paper wrapper instructions - and the first Zolo models were sold no more and no less than in the New York Museum of Modern Art.

Unusual construction sets, which stand out even in the traditionally vibrant children's goods industry with their eccentricity, fun appeal and huge creative potential, quickly gained popularity not only among children, but also among adults. Over the years, Zolo toys have received many solid awards, and leading specialized magazines and catalogs, recognizing the company's significant contribution to the "toy" industry, do not hesitate to put it on a par with the world's largest manufacturers of children's goods. In 2003, Zola products, along with the most famous toys of the 20th century, were mentioned in the book "The Power of Play: One Hundred Years", published by the American Toy Manufacturers Association for its anniversary.

Marble Mania - toys for future geniuses

Kinetic constructors Marble Mania These are wonderful toys that can capture the attention of children for long hours. In addition to entertainment constructors Marble Mania They also have great development potential. They give the child intuitive ideas about the basic laws of kinetics, dynamics and mechanics, improve technical abilities and spatial sense, and also have a huge beneficial effect on the development of fine motor skills of the hands, which, as you know, is directly related to the level of development of intelligence and speech.

Dynamic designs for the movement of marble balls (marble runs) have been known in England and the USA for several centuries. In the days of Tom Sawyer, children (and often adults) built them from any materials at hand - scraps of wood, pipes, cubes, planks and household items. Today, the construction of "kinetic sculptures" also has many fans and is even considered a special kind of art. However, the educational potential of such structures is no less valued.

Construction set MARBLE MANIA 109441 Galaxy

In the West, volumetric labyrinths are used to demonstrate the basic laws of physics in children's educational centers and even schools. And home constructors of this type allow children to independently experiment with parts and assemblies, creating labyrinths of various levels of complexity. In recent years, kinetic designers have begun to enjoy well-deserved attention in Russia as well. The high-quality models of Marble Mania belong to the most popular toys of their group.

The goal of the game with the Marble Mania constructor is to build a three-dimensional labyrinth in which the balls, with the help of special devices, could make their way from the highest to the lowest point. To do this, grooves of various shapes and auxiliary mechanisms are used that create sound effects, raise and lower the balls to different levels or shoot them in the right direction. The movable mechanisms of the designer are set in motion by gears, working with which allows the child to realize or improve his technical skills. The designers are powered by conventional AA batteries.

Every constructor Marble Mania designed to create a large vertical labyrinth. The model line includes both ordinary construction kits with a different number of parts, and original models that will allow you to arrange real ball races or even glow in the dark. From the details of each designer, you can assemble not only large, but also less complex kinetic structures. And the full compatibility of all Marble Mania models with each other makes it possible to create giant labyrinths, the observation of which will become a favorite entertainment not only for children, but also for adults.

Makedo - ingenious simplicity

The Makedo brand was born in Australia. Like almost everything exported from the Green Continent, Makedo products, with their outward simplicity, are distinguished by their fresh approach, phenomenal potential, the complete absence of analogues in Europe or America, and incomparable environmental friendliness.

Makedo was founded by Australian designer Paul Justin. Having spent several years designing toys for well-known Australian companies, Justin had the idea of ​​creating a game that would be more of a system than a single model, address social and environmental aspects, and at the same time be fun, simple and durable. And yet, the first Makedo constructor appeared spontaneously - Justin was inspired by his invention while playing together with his four-year-old son, who needed special tools to build incredible structures from the most ordinary household items.

Makedo constructors made their debut in 2008 at architecture and design exhibitions, but very quickly found their place on the shelves of children's stores. Within a few years, Makedo designers conquered Australia and crossed the ocean. Currently, the company is actively growing, expanding its lineup, developing international cooperation and winning the hearts of tens of thousands of "homemade" around the world.

Concept Makedo constructors is based on a simple truth known to all parents: give your child a new toy and it will keep him busy for an hour, give a cardboard box and he will play with it all day. However, Makedo's "designer" can only be called a stretch. This fantastic toy does not contain actual building parts - only fasteners are contained in a cardboard box made of recycled paper: studs, clips, hinges and a plastic file with a safety awl on the handle for cutting cardboard and piercing holes. Everything else must be chosen by the children. And if parents who are accustomed to finished products may be surprised, then the kids themselves are delighted - after all, with the help of the Makedo set, such interesting things as cardboard or plastic packaging, an egg carton, wrapping cloth or disposable tableware can find a new life in the form fantasy creature, spaceship or toy house.

IN the designer kit includes a small instruction "for inspiration". More detailed instructions are rejected by the Makedo concept itself - after all, children, who are not limited in any way in their creativity, no doubt, themselves will perfectly find use for the details of this constructor. Well, when the assembled structures cease to amuse, they can be easily disassembled and used Makedo fasteners to build new, no less wonderful structures. Kushies Baby are incredible toys for the little ones.

Kushies Baby was founded over 50 years ago in the small town of Stony Creek, Ontario, about an hour from Toronto. Today the company is a leading Canadian manufacturer of high quality children's clothing and educational accessories for babies. However, in 1953 it was a tiny family business specializing in the manufacture of clothes for dolls - the founder of the company, Mary Malinowski, sewed her own.

The company, originally called Diana Dolls Wear, grew rapidly. Soon, doll clothes under this brand appeared in most Canadian children's stores, and a decade later the company became the only national manufacturer of doll accessories in Canada, which were actively sold not only in the domestic market, but also in the United States.

By the beginning of the 90s, expanding the range of its products, the company began producing goods for children in their first years of life. The new product line was named Kushies, which soon replaced the company's old name, Diana Dolls Wear. The funny word Kushies (cushy - English light, pleasant) combined the ideas of softness and comfort. Today, under this brand, more than 350 items of goods are produced from clothes and reusable diapers made from the company's patented organic cotton material to strollers and children's furniture.

Raduga OJSC is a factory that has been working for more than fifty years for the sake of the development of the child, for the sake of his happy childhood, a worthy future.

The Lyangasovskaya toy factory (it was from this name that Raduga began its career) was born thanks to changes in the policy of the Soviet state. One leader was replaced by another, and among other changes, economic ones also took place: artel production, widespread among the population of Russia since the second half of the 17th century, gradually faded away. In 1960, on the basis of the Pasegovskaya artel for the manufacture of musical toys and the Simakovskaya artel "Metalist", located in the area of ​​​​the village of Strizhi, the Lyangasovskaya toy factory was organized.

In 1970, an event occurred that predetermined the further happy fate of the factory - a building was built in which cardboard and printing production was organized. A large Planet printing press, three rotaprinters, punch presses, two crucible machines, and a varnishing line helped the factory workers to give the children of the seventies a happy childhood.

Meanwhile, the factory grew and developed. From 1963 to 1990, the factory was part of the Vyatka association, and this had a beneficial effect on its development - with the help of the association, construction and equipment went much faster. In 1985 equipment of joint production Japan-Germany was installed on new tinplate printing lines. The production of a metal toy begins, including those very wonderful little cars that at that time, probably, every Kirov child had.

In 1990, the policy and economy of the state once again underwent significant changes, and this again affected the life of the Lyangasovskaya toy factory - it became an open joint-stock company and acquired its modern name - "Rainbow". Since 2001, Raduga has been living and working in close contact with JSC Vesna, which has a positive effect on the development of production.

Production of the factory "Rainbow" is, indeed, a rainbow of names (there are more than four hundred of them!), colors, opportunities for the development of small buyers of products.

Technical and figurative toys are classified into clockwork and non-clockwork. Clockwork metal toys have the main basis - engines of various types. The simplest toys use engines with wire coil springs, as well as stamped gears. In expensive and complex toys, motors with tape coil springs are used, as well as milled gear wheels. Occasionally, other engines are also used, such as electric, water, pneumatic, steam, inertial, internal combustion.

There were several types of metal technical toys.
1. Transport
2. Tools, machines, machine tools,
3. Trade equipment, household items
4. Instruments and apparatus
5. Pistols, shotguns
6. Metal constructors, constructors.

The type of transport toys included urban, rail, air and water transport, namely, buses, tram cars, cars, locomotives, wagons, motor ships, steamboats, boats, barges, yachts, tugboats, warships, gliders, airplanes, gliders, airships , as well as transport facilities, service facilities, such as stations, garages, piers, hangars, traffic lights, rails, crosses, arrows, dead ends and other structures.

A number of transport toys were equipped with additional manual mechanisms, such as levers that tilted dump truck bodies, levers that raised fire truck ladders, winches, steamboat booms and other manual control parts. The doors of some cars and wagons were opening, and the steering was functioning. Some toys had automatic control, namely, forward with reverse, riding in a figure eight, in a circle, turning at an angle and other functions.

A number of toys were equipped with horns and working headlights. Transport toys were divided depending on the length by size.
Small cars ranged from 50 to 100mm, medium from 150 to 250mm, large from 300 to 500mm and so on. They also separated ships from aircraft. Railway toys were on a scale of 1 to 100, 1 to 50 and 1 to 30 natural size.

Production.
Metal toys were made mainly from pickled sheet steel with a thickness of 0.3 to 1.0 mm, white and black tinplate with a thickness of 0.25 to 0.50 mm, roofing iron and dynamo steel with a thickness of 0.5 to 0.7 mm , and light aluminum alloys with aluminum sheet waste. Decapitated steel was used to make deep drawings of complex configuration parts of toys, as well as for ship hulls and toy passenger car bodies. Troughs, washbasins, bathtubs, dishes were made of tinplate, that is, those toys that come into contact with water to prevent corrosion.

The manufacture of metal toys consists of several main stages.
1. Metal preparation including sorting, cutting and cleaning
2. Stamping on presses, consisting of punching, drawing, bending
3. Grinding, as well as tumbling, produced in drums, for small parts, to remove burrs, sharp edges.
4. Assembly, finishing and painting.

The assembly was done by connecting parts into finished products and assemblies. The most common connection of parts was considered to be a reed connection. Its essence is in the bending of the tongues, which were passed through slotted holes. Another popular connection method was electric spot welding and seam assembly. It was used in the manufacture of buckets and watering cans. The parts were connected with soft solders. This method was used to keep the tightness of toys, such as cisterns, washbasins, pumps.

Screw connections were used occasionally, mainly in collapsible toys and various designers used screw connections. Various methods were used for finishing and painting. The most popular was the coating of the surface of toys with enamel paints and nitro paints with mechanical spray guns. The coloring was done in three layers, and then sinitro paintings were applied with oil and enamel paints with brushes or through a stencil manually. Drawing drawings on toys by lithographic printing or decalcomania was recognized as the best color.

Reception and sorting of metal toys.
They were carried out by the method of external examination and checking the operation of toys with a clockwork mechanism. Visually, they assessed the quality of coloring, the fidelity of the shape of toys, the assessment of the connections of parts, the presence of cutting edges, burrs, the assembly quality of parts of winding mechanisms, and so on. Clockwork toy mechanisms are first checked by an incomplete key winding.

When it becomes clear that the mechanism is functioning well, the toy is turned on completely, and not to failure, so as not to break the springs. The first grade included metal toys that met all the quality requirements of the current technical specifications. The second grade included toys with defects that did not interfere with the play properties of the toys and did not distort their appearance. An example is corrosion up to fifteen mm long with a new paint job, or reduced mileage of clockwork toys by 30 percent against specifications.

Package.
Large metal toys were packaged individually. Smaller toys were wrapped in paper, after which they were packed in containers. Usually, transport toys, that is, constructors, machines, tools, machines and other technical toys, were packed in their rigid packaging with an artfully designed label. Instructions for handling the toy were always included in the package.
There were toys, such as carts, buckets, wheelchairs, shovels, stoves, watering cans, bathtubs and a number of others, which were necessarily wrapped in three layers of paper, where the first layer was always soft. Transportation of toys was carried out with care, without a shaft and heaps. But at the wheelchairs, which are equipped with sticks, all accessories were removed during transportation and laid next to the toys.

Metal toys had to be stored at a certain temperature and relative humidity. Strong fluctuations in temperature, dank air were not allowed, which could damage and put a metal toy out of order, as well as create metal corrosion.


For the production of such toys (rubber toys) in Russia, plastisol is mainly used. This material is a thermoset polymer based on polyvinyl chloride. Before coloring, the mass is ordinary sour cream in color and consistency. In the future, it will be possible to give it color with the help of an organic dye.
As a result of heat treatment in an oven, the material hardens in the mold and acquires properties similar to soft rubber. This method is called rotational formatting. Let's consider this stage more specifically: the plastisol is poured into a special sealed metal mold that rotates in a red-hot furnace, then the thickened material is cooled in specially designed chambers.

At the last stage, the workpiece is removed from the mold and given its natural and familiar color. You can do this with a brush or airbrush. After completing all the above instructions, the finished product is placed in the package. It can be a plastic bag or a silicone bag. Storage also requires certain conditions to be met. Namely: these should be clean warehouses that do not contain a lot of dust and dirt, and toys should not be directly exposed to sunlight.

An experienced glassblower can make up to 200 balls in one shift. The next step is the silvering process. A glass-blower-created ball is filled with a solution consisting of ammonia, as well as ordinary distilled water and silver oxide, after which it is immersed in a certain container with a certain temperature of 42 degrees. The ball turns silver immediately after being submerged. Subsequent painting and drying are a preparatory stage, after which the ball is sent to the artists. This is the most interesting and exciting moment.

At this stage, absolutely all toys acquire directly the individuality and originality of their shapes and colors, because each toy is painted with a brush, which means that it is already a real work of art.
